    Help Provide Clothing to Unhoused and Low-Income San Franciscans

    The Free Clothing Program (FCP) at St. Anthony’s, the largest of its kind in San Francisco, provides new and gently-used clothing items to individuals and families. Volunteers assist our program by sorting and organizing clothing donations, ensuring 10,000 people annually have access to fresh, clean, and high-quality clothing.

    Volunteers will also have the chance to engage with our guests as they shop. Volunteers can assist our "shoppers," helping them to find the free items-clothing, shoes, and linens-that best suit their needs.

    Our objective at St. Anthony’s is to cater to the whole person and empower them to achieve lasting, positive change in their lives. The community of volunteers here makes that work possible.
